Outlook Therapeutics priced a $55 million public offering of 55.6 million shares plus warrants at $0.99 per unit, with net proceeds of about $51.1 million to fund the US launch of LYTENAVA.

Public Offering Priced
55,555,556 shares plus warrants to purchase 55,555,556 shares at combined price of $0.99 per share, for total gross proceeds of $55.0 million.

Net Proceeds and Use
Net proceeds of approximately $51.1 million after underwriting discounts and expenses, to fund US commercial launch of LYTENAVA and working capital.

Warrant Terms
Warrants exercisable immediately at $1.10 per share, expire five years from issuance; underwriters have 30-day option for 8,333,333 additional shares/warrants.

Dilution Impact
Offering increases outstanding shares from 187.1 million to 242.7 million, a 29.7% increase; immediate dilution of $0.75 per share to new investors.

Outlook Therapeutics is raising $55 million in a public offering of 55.6 million shares plus warrants, priced at $0.99 per unit. The deal is highly dilutive — the offering nearly doubles the current share count of 187 million — but it provides critical capital to fund the US commercial launch of LYTENAVA, which received FDA approval in July 2026. The company had only $11.2 million in cash as of June 30, 2026, and this raise extends its runway into Q2 2027. The warrants, exercisable at $1.10, add further potential dilution if the stock rises. The offering price is below the last reported sale price of $1.10 on August 12, 2026, indicating a discount to market.
